All I can say is, I hope we were the extreme exception regarding our roofing experience with this company. Our General Contractor (GC) sourced/hired ACCI to install a new torch down (modified bitumen) for our extensive remodel in La Jolla. Not even a month after install (around Dec 2017), we had a light rain and the roof failed, leaking into our home. Had I not discovered the leak (about 1am) and put a large plastic storage bin under dripping water, we would have add even more water damage.
By the time GC and ""Larry Jr."" from ACCI Roofing Services came out to inspect, we still had ponding water that not only lasted well after 48 hours, even 6-7 days! GAF, the manufacturer of the material used, will void their warranty with any ponding after 48 hours.
Having already looked up the CSLB Contractor codes, I knew that a minimum slope should have been provided (1/4:12) we the roof was installed- even the rep from GAF that Larry Jr had me contact verified that - it's the roofer and/or GC's duty to build to code!
However, when I point blank asked both GC and Larry Jr. about this they both had nothing to say/answer. Rather they both went to rambling off unacceptable 'band aid' options. We then had a friend that is the President of a large commercial roofing company in LA take a look. He couldn't believe what he saw.
In addition to a failed roof, they didn't use the right drip edge material being so close to the ocean, they didn't heat up the material enough nor provide proper 'bleed out' at seams and failed to use the correct sealant at the perimeter. The entire roof needed to be replaced.
It wasn't until we hired an expert consultant who confirmed the previous assessment that we finally got the money paid for the worthless roof. However, we did not get reimbursed the cost to remove it (yet!). We received several new bids from reputable roof companies and every single one of them noted the subpar job we were given. There were so many issues and things done incorrectly that some were downright angry that a colleague would tarnish their industry so blatantly.
In any event, we lost four and a half months of work/progress due to Larry Jr and GC not manning up and admitting their blunder back in December. The stucco cannot go on until the roof is done. Time is money and ACCI Roofing Services had certainly cost us a lot of both, not to mention stress.
I cannot nor will not recommend this company because they tried to pass this roof off.
